基于计划驱动的图像数据处理系统云计算弹性伸缩设计

图像数据处理系统资源构建在专有云上,针对系统任务负载非周期变化、任务计划强关联等特点,利用图像数据处理计划可预测业务负载的优点,设计了基于计划的任务量预测自定义指标,提出了基于计划驱动的弹性伸缩策略和系统设计.通过实验环境测试,实现了计算资源根据业务负载动态调整,进一步提高了资源利用率.同时增加了基于CPU负载的伸缩保底策略,提高了系统可靠性.
Cloud Computing Elastic Scaling Design for Image Data Processing System Based on Plan-driven
Image data processing system resources are built on a private cloud.According to the characteristics of non-periodic changes of system task load and strong correlation of the task plans,and using the advantage of image data processing plans to predict business load,a user-defined index for task quantity prediction based on plans is designed,and an elastic scaling strategy and system design based on plan-driven is proposed.Through experimental environment testing,the dynamic adjustment of computing resources based on business load has been realized,and the resource utilization has been improved.At the same time,a scalable guaranteed strategy based on CPU load has been added to improve the system reliability.
